Meanwhile, police in Naivasha town are investigating an incident in which a fight between a motorcycle operator and his client over charges left the latter dead.
The passenger collapsed in a heap and died minutes later following the incident in Karai estate along the Nairobi-Nakuru highway.
The two were arguing over Sh300 charges when a fight broke out on Sunday evening leading to the unfortunate death with the operator going into hiding.
Trouble started after the victim sought the services of the operator at around 9 pm to ferry him from one of the bars located along the highway to his home.
A witness Joel Kibe said that upon arriving at his home, the deceased could not remember his pin leading to a confrontation with the operator.
“In the process, the operator decided to take the drunken passenger to the Karai police post but they disagreed further leading to a fight,” he said.
He added that the operator left the deceased unconscious only for the body to be found on Monday morning by his kin.
